BUILDING TEST COORDINATOR

ACTIVITIES JOB DESCRIPTION

JOB DESCRIPTION: BUILDING TEST COORDINATOR
RANGE: (3) $1,766.00
TERM: School Year (10 Months)
(Potentially Pro-rated)

The Building Test Coordinator has varying roles dependent upon the testing happening. This document is split into
parts by assessment. For assessments not listed (DIAL, KDP), Central Office Personnel will work directly with the
teachers administering the assessments, and you may or may not be asked to assist. The district recognizes that the
time, care, and accountability needed to ensure smooth, consistent, and secure testing needs a devoted individual at
each site. It is the responsibility of the BTC to attend all scheduled trainings regarding testing, whether they are
offered by the Assessment Department, Student Services, Curriculum & Instruction, or an outside entity such as the
State of Alaska or WIDA.

PEAKS (regulated by the state)
BEFORE TESTING

 Test Security Agreements
o Verify that all your test administrators have signed level 4 TSA’s 

INSIGHT client check
o Verify that all your student computers have the INSIGHT client installed
o Work with the Site Tech to perform the configuration check, report any issues to InfoTech 

Student Rostering
o Roster all students into test sessions, if you have difficulties, report them to Caitlin immediately 

Test tickets
o These are secure test items, they must be kept secure until students test
o Print them and organize them by grade or teacher/classroom, however your students will test
o Advise teachers to keep track of who does NOT test, keep their test tickets separate
o Make-up students can use their original test ticket 

Scratch paper/graph paper
o Make sure you have graph paper and blank scratch paper for each classroom that will be testing 

Cover up or remove materials on the walls where students will test 
Broadcast on VHF or radio the dates students will be testing, go to bed early, eat breakfast, etc… 
Headphones

o Students who get the text-to-speech accommodation MUST have headphones
o Other students may use headphones to block noise while they test, do you have enough? If you

anticipate needing additional headphones, notify Caitlin by December 15.
o If you allow any students to do this you must give ALL students the option to use headphones

while they test
 Test Administrator Directions & Tech Support Guide

o Each test administrator needs a paper copy of the TAD and Tech Support Guide 
Accommodations

o Students who receive accommodations per their IEP must be given accommodations on their
PEAKS test.

o Verify the list of student accommodations with Student Services, the Counselor, SPED teachers at
your site, and the test proctor to ensure accuracy and compliance. Ensure that Student Services has
the appropriate forms signed by the test administrator 

Seating arrangements, determine the following:
o Is there enough room for all the students to test?
o Is there enough space between each seat?
o Is there an established seating chart?

North Slope Borough School District

Homeschool students
o When will they test? Where will they test? Who will administer the test?
o Ensure that Homeschooled students have been rostered BEFORE testing begins and that

Assessment is aware of them/ has contacted their home school 
Create a plan for disruptive students

o Who are they?
o Should they test in a separate location?
o Who will test them, where will they test?

DURING TESTING
Teacher cell phones and laptops

o Teachers may not have anywhere to store their cell phones or laptops
o Laptops and cell phones can be stored in the room where students test 

Cell phones must be off or silent and out of sight (not in your pocket)
 Computers should be out of sight
 Teachers are not to use their cell phone or laptop during the test session, they can

however use their cell phone in the case of an emergency, ONLY IF NO LANDLINE IS
PRESENT

 Post signs
o No electronics
o Testing, do not disturb

 Security or ethics breach
o Report any security breach (electronics in testing room, lost test materials, test materials copied in

any way, etc.) to Caitlin immediately, and document in writing
o Report any ethics breach (test administrator coaching students, helping students, paraphrasing

questions, etc.) to Caitlin immediately, and document in writing
 Special Circumstances: student/parent refusal, medical waiver, absent student, or invalidation

o Document on Irregularity Report
 Create a plan with your staff to ensure students know what they can do after they finish testing

o Should they quietly read a book?
o Can they leave the room?

AFTER TESTING
Collect all Irregularity Reports

o Scan/email all Irregularity Reports to Caitlin
 Document all parent refusals and send to Caitlin
 Collect all test tickets

o After a student has finished both parts of a test their test ticket should be shredded
o Keep the test tickets for students who have not yet tested

 Shred all used scratch paper
o Teachers can do this as soon as they finish testing, or they can turn it in to you with their secure

test items, it is kept secure until it is shredded
